Constitutional Law is a branch of law that deals with the principles and rules governing the structure, powers, and duties of government institutions, as well as the rights and responsibilities of individuals. It is based on the Constitution, which is the supreme law of a nation and outlines the fundamental principles and values that govern a country.

Typically, Constitutional Law is taught at the college level, but it may also be offered as an elective course in high school. It is a subject that is commonly studied by law students, political science majors, and students pursuing a degree in government or public policy.

Some of the topics covered in Constitutional Law include the separation of powers, federalism, individual rights and liberties, and the interpretation and application of the Constitution. Students will also learn about landmark Supreme Court cases that have shaped our understanding of the Constitution and its role in our government.
